Axtra3D has established its new European headquarters in Vicenza, Italy, signaling a significant expansion of its industrial additive manufacturing capabilities.
Axtra3D, a company specializing in additive manufacturing, has officially opened its new European headquarters located in Vicenza, Italy. This strategic move represents a significant step in the company's growth and its commitment to strengthening its presence within the industrial additive manufacturing sector.
The establishment of this new facility in Vicenza is expected to bolster Axtra3D's production capabilities and enhance its service offerings to European clients. The company focuses on advancing additive manufacturing technologies, aiming to provide innovative solutions for various industrial applications.
This expansion into Vicenza underscores Axtra3D's dedication to meeting the increasing demand for advanced 3D printing solutions across Europe. The new headquarters will serve as a central hub for the company's operations, facilitating research, development, and manufacturing processes.
